Posted by: Thorshammer Dec 12 2005, 11:28 AM

Thanks Everyone,

Just call me Dr. Miracle av-943.gif

FIAT???? WTF These sheeplove.gif Need to get their heads out of their bootyshake.gif and take a fresh breath. But I've got to give Greg Creamer his "props" he caught the mistake.

For me personally, most of these guys are way too sedate when they win, almost like they are too cool to look like it means something. You won, even if it is a local regional race, you won, celebrate like the world is coming to an end, you never know when it will be your time to go. I celebrated like that at Watkins Glen this year, too bad there were no Victory laps for the winner.

I had one helluva week. We worked really hard, and some of you may not know the car was completed only 10 minute before the first practice on Monday. then I got black flagged in that practice after only a couple laps for a non compliant roll cage hoop??? They thought I was sitting too high in the car. We had to remount the seat before the next day and cut the windscreen down so I could see. It was crazy. Then the wheels, and the next day air for new studs, and the bent trailing arm.... ETC

It was alot of fun, and the journey was better than the prize. Which is really how it should be.
